If you didn’t receive your invitation, you can access your evaluations through Course-Instructor Evaluations channel on the Academic Services tab in MyCharleston, through a link on OAKS, or coursereview.cofc.edu. You can also email [email protected]

Go to coursereview.cofc.edu and log in using your Cougars username and password. This information is NOT submitted as part of the feedback data. ALL COURSE SURVEYS ARE ANONYMOUS. You can also access your Course Survey Response Rates and Reports via your OAKS, MyCharleston, or your mobile device.Apr 12, 2020

Are course evaluations really anonymous?

Yes, student responses are anonymous. Instructors do not know which students responded or what responses individual students provided. However, instructors can track overall response rates for their courses.

Do course evaluations matter?

In addition to helping professors improve their classes, these evaluations play a role in helping administration make tenure decisions and influence where potential raises are offered, Carini said. Though they aren't the deciding factor, these surveys are one component of how teaching is evaluated.Nov 18, 2020

How many hours of PDE?

PDE courses can be designed for three, two, or one hours of graduate credit. The minimum number of class instructional contact hours for 3 credits is 45 hours. The minimum number of class instructional contact hours for 2 credits is 30 hours.

Is class attendance required for PDE?

If, for serious personal or medical reasons, several classes are missed, the instructor should be informed of the reason. A student may be dropped from a course for excessive absences (i.e., in excess of 15% of course time). A student enrolled in a PDE course must attend at least 85% of the total class hours required for course completion.

Declining AP, Ib and/or Transfer Credit

  • Students may decline transfer credit, AP credit and/or IB credit by completing the appropriate form in the Forms pageof the Transfer Resource Center's website. Students may decline transfer credit in order to add another transfer course(s) without going over the maximum hours of transfer credit allowed.
